메뉴 건너뛰기


    private function intercept()
    {
        intercept(
            \Xpressengine\User\Guard::class . '@attempt',
            'loginlog_auth_:attempt',
            function ($func, array $credentials = [], $remember = false) {

                $result = $func($credentials, $remember);
                
                $input = request()->all();


                // 로그인 후
                if ($result == true) {
                    // 로그인 성공
                    \XeDB::table('loginlog')->insert(
                        ['user_id' => $user_id,
                         'display_name' => $display_name,
                         'email' => $input['email'],
                         'ipaddress' => 0,
                         'is_succeed' => 'Y',
                         'platform' => '',
                         'browser' => ''
                        ]
                    );
                } else {
                    // 로그인 실패
                    /*XeDB::table('loginlog')->insert(
                        ['user_id' => 'john@example.com',
                         'display_name' => 0,
                         'email' => 0,
                         'ipaddress' => 0,
                         'is_succeed' => 'N',
                         'platform' => 'Y',
                         'browser' => 'Y'
                        ]
                    );*/
                }

                return $result;
            }
        );
    }

 

로그인 실패/성공 여부를 DB에 기록하고 있는데요.
위 소스코드의 intercept 내 에서 User ID와 display_name을 어떻게 가져올 수 있을까요?

제목 작성자 추천수 조회수 작성
플러그인 제작 중 궁금한 것이 있어 질문 올립니다. 2 SimpleCode 0 145 2019-05-10 플러그인 제작 중 궁금한 것이 있어 질문 올립니다.
SimpleCode 2019-05-10 145 2
https 관리자페이지 pageModal 문제 4 백금열 0 330 2019-05-09 https 관리자페이지 pageModal 문제
백금열 2019-05-09 330 4
혹시 멀티 사이트를 지원하나요? 지원한다면 어떻게 구현할 수 있을까요? 3 SimpleCode 0 133 2019-05-07 혹시 멀티 사이트를 지원하나요? 지원한다면 어떻게 구현할 수 있을까요?
SimpleCode 2019-05-07 133 3
league/flysystem-aws-s3-v3 ~1.0 컴포저 설치 오류입니다 3 하마천재 0 149 2019-05-07 league/flysystem-aws-s3-v3 ~1.0 컴포저 설치 오류입니다
하마천재 2019-05-07 149 3
부트스트랩 bootstrap.css 경로 오류 문제입니다. 1 하마천재 0 155 2019-05-04 부트스트랩 bootstrap.css 경로 오류 문제입니다.
하마천재 2019-05-04 155 1
설치 오류 도와주세요ㅠㅠ 2 file 쿠크코키 0 151 2019-05-04 설치 오류 도와주세요ㅠㅠ file
쿠크코키 2019-05-04 151 2
최근 배포판 외부페이지 기능이 없어졌나요? 2 하마천재 0 192 2019-05-03 최근 배포판 외부페이지 기능이 없어졌나요?
하마천재 2019-05-03 192 2
관리자페이지 권한 생성 문의 2 백금열 0 136 2019-05-03 관리자페이지 권한 생성 문의
백금열 2019-05-03 136 2
테마 변경이 안됩니다. 1 하마천재 0 141 2019-05-03 테마 변경이 안됩니다.
하마천재 2019-05-03 141 1
설정시 이미지 등록 DB 건의 1 백금열 0 140 2019-05-03 설정시 이미지 등록 DB 건의
백금열 2019-05-03 140 1